DECISION
Adjudicator: David Muir Date: August 4, 2017 Citation: 2017 HRTO 1006 Indexed as: Tsegayewendenmagenhu v. Vertica Resident Services Inc.
1This is an Application filed under section 45.9(3) of Part IV of the Human Rights Code, R.S.O. 1990, c. H.19, as amended (the “Code”).
2On June 2, 2017 the Tribunal wrote to the applicant by email requesting that he provide mutually agreeable dates to reschedule the hearing in this case. The applicant did not respond to this request and the time for doing so passed.
3On June 16, 2017 the Tribunal wrote to the applicant again by email directing that the applicant confirm his intentions with respect to this case. The applicant was directed that if he wished to proceed with the Application, he must respond to the June 2, 2017 email and provided dates for the hearing by June 23, 2017 failing which the applicant may be dismissed as abandoned.
4The emails were sent to the email address provided by the applicant in his Application and there is no indication that they were not received by him.
5The applicant did not respond as directed and does not appear to have made any contact with the Tribunal.
6In all of the circumstances I find that the applicant has abandoned this Application and it is dismissed.
